SECTION 28-2-5

   § 28-2-5  Compensation of persons assignedto work. – All persons required to work under this chapter shall receive compensation ofnot less than the wage or salary paid to others engaged in the same nature ofwork to which each person is assigned. If any person is assigned to work forany department, board, division, or commission of the state, then thecompensation of the person shall be paid to him by the department, board,division, or commission out of the appropriation made to it by the state. Ifany person is assigned to work for any county or for any municipality, or forany private employer, then the compensation of the person shall be paid to himby the county or municipality, or by the private employer, accepting hisservices.
